      <description>&lt;P&gt;You can just enter a total, or group items together (ex: prescriptions, dental, etc...), but you can only claim amounts for medical expenses that you paid yourself, that weren't reimbursed by someone else (ex: insurance or an employer, etc...). So if you paid $1000 for a dental procedure, but your insurance covered $800, then you can only claim the $200 difference.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;There's no maximum amount of medical expenses that you can claim, only a minimum. You can claim the total of the eligible expenses minus the lesser of the following amounts: $2,834 or 3% of your net income (line 23600 of your tax return). However, the medical expense credit is non-refundable, so it can only be used to reduce or eliminate taxes owing. It can't &amp;nbsp;be used to generate or increase a refund.&lt;/P&gt;
